Ecuador`s secondary agricultural nutrients import shipments in 2024 saw significant growth, with top exporting countries being Spain, Norway, Colombia, USA, and Mexico. The Market Top 5 Importing Countries and Market Competition (HHI) Analysis remained competitive with a low Herfindahl-Hirschman Index (HHI) concentration in 2024, indicating a diverse range of suppliers. The compound annual growth rate (CAGR) from 2020 to 2024 was an impressive 29.8%, showcasing a rapidly expanding Market Top 5 Importing Countries and Market Competition (HHI) Analysis. The growth rate from 2023 to 2024 was also strong at 28.67%, pointing towards a promising outlook for the industry in Ecuador.
